Description

"A truly unique, extended five bedroom detached house, which is beautifully presented throughout, occupying a stunning position on the edge of the development, siding onto open countryside. The house was built in 1998 by Bovis Homes and has been loved and cared for by the current owners since 2018 and extended in 2021. You enter through the front door into the spacious entrance hall with a WC, stairs rising to the first floor and doors opening to the principal reception rooms.

The living room is situated to one side of the house and enjoys windows to dual aspects and with large patio doors opening to the rear garden, allowing lots of natural light to enter the room. The second reception room currently used as a study is positioned at the opposite side to the lounge at the front of the house, with a window to the front aspect and a door to the utility room and steps down into the kitchen. The cinema room is positioned at the rear of the house, with a window to the rear aspect and a understairs cupboard.

The kitchen diner is located at the far end of the house, in the extension and benefits lots of natural light from bi folding doors to the rear terrace and garden, and a window to the front aspect. There are a variety of modern fitted wall and base units with ample storage cupboards and drawers, work surfaces over and inset sink with drainer. There are a range of built in appliances, which include a fridge, freezer, wine cooler and dishwasher as well as space for a range style cooker. There is a breakfast bar and space for a dining table in front the bi folding doors and contemporary lighting throughout. There is a useful walk in pantry and stairs to the master suite above. The utility room is fitted with work top, inset sink, additional storage and space for a washing machine and dryer. An external door opens to the rear of the house.

Upstairs, on the first floor landing of the original house, there are four bedrooms, including what was the master suite, and the family bathroom. The old master bedroom benefits from a walkthrough dressing room with fitted wardrobes, providing ample storage. A door opens to the en suite shower room, with a WC and wash basin. There are three other bedrooms, two with built in wardrobes and the family bathroom, which is partially tiled and is fitted with a three piece suite including WC, washbasin, and bath with shower over.

Above the kitchen, a separate staircase rises to one of the most incredible master suites you are ever likely to see! There is a large skylight overhead as you climb the stairs and a window to the rear, which floods the landing and stairwell with natural light. A door opens to the bedroom, which is an impressive size, has windows to dual aspects and a built in wardrobe. A contemporary spiral staircase rises to a breathtaking en suite, which is fitted with a four piece suite including WC, twin washbasins, large walk in shower, and a freestanding bath with unspoiled views across the adjacent countryside and also with skylight windows overhead.

Outside, to the rear of the property there is a great size garden, arranged over multiple levels. Initially, there is a raised terrace area, which leads onto a lawn with fenced boarders. Below this is a sunken patio area, with a garden bar ready to host any party you might throw at it! A side gate provides access to the front, with a timber clad garage with power supply and Eazee EV charging point and a large gravel driveway for up to five vehicles. The garage has a personnel door and a pitched roof with potential storage area in the eves space. Beside the house is an attractive open field paddock, home to several horses and ponies to keep you company whilst you enjoy a glass or two on the terrace.

Tenure Freehold. Council Tax Band F. Gas Mains Supply. Water Mains Supply. Electric Mains Supply. Drainage Mains Supply. EPC Band D. Internet ADSL 14 mbps . EV Charging Installed."
